Web8 okt. 2024 · Newton’s Second Law: the Law of Force and Acceleration. “Force is equal to the change in momentum (mV) per change in time. For a constant mass, force equals mass times acceleration: F=ma.”. Or simply put – the relationship between an object’s mass (m), its acceleration (a) and the applied force (F) is F= ma. The key point to take away ... WebWorked examples of Newton's Second Law. Two people are pushing a car, a pplying forces of 275N and 395N to the right. Friction provides an opposing force of 560N to the left. If the mass of the car is 1850kg, find its acceleration.
